Output 614677f026720f3eb24f9ec87c92ce23fca23007e2a21cf21f6c3e70f16a7c9e:1

value
534229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d8287b9f6f3ff8683df4619038d844f9b494cb OP_EQUAL
address
3B4oo3LQeFwAZVPET8DpT7B3Cxjs2Uq3hx
transaction
614677f026720f3eb24f9ec87c92ce23fca23007e2a21cf21f6c3e70f16a7c9e
spent
true